Strongs H8214

H8214

שְׁפַל (shᵉphal) v (shef-al')
Source: (Aramaic) corresponding to H8213

KJV: abase, humble, put down, subdue.

Brown, Driver, Briggs lexicon entry

Type: root" cite="full" form="false
[שְׁפֵל] vb. be low {1117}

Appears in a total of 4 verses:
